mar 24, 1765 - The Quartering Act is Passed
Description:
The Quartering Act required American colonies to house the British soldiers. They were to house them in barracks. If those were too small and wouldn't everyone, soldiers were to go stay in stables, inns, and other different local places. This led to organized protest that later took place in 1765.
